Hugging Face Urges US Government to Focus on Open-Source AI Development

March 21, 2025

Hugging Face, a leading platform in AI development, has made a significant appeal to the US government through a statement to the Office of Science and Technology Policy (OSTP). The company emphasizes the importance of prioritizing open-source development in the upcoming AI Action Plan, focusing on three main pillars: strengthening open-source ecosystems, ensuring the efficient and reliable adoption of AI, and promoting security and standards in technological development.

Economic and Public Benefits

Economic Impact

Open technical systems are identified as powerful multipliers for economic growth. Hugging Face references estimates that suggest the absence of open-source software contributions could result in an average GDP loss of 2.2% for countries. The economic implications of open-source development are profound, as these contributions enable cost savings, drive innovation, and create new opportunities across various sectors.

By reducing the barriers to entry, open-source models facilitate broader participation in AI development, leading to a more dynamic and competitive market. This inclusivity can spur economic growth by fostering innovation and reducing costs associated with proprietary systems. Hugging Face underscores that the economic benefits of open-source AI are significant and far-reaching, impacting not only the technology sector but the economy as a whole.

Policy Implications

The company references the European Commission’s acknowledgment of the economic benefits of open-source software. This has prompted efforts to streamline open-sourcing government software, indicating a significant impact on policy and economic strategy. By recognizing the value of open-source contributions, governments can develop policies that promote technological innovation and economic growth.

Such policies can include funding for open-source projects, support for collaborative research initiatives, and incentives for companies to adopt open-source solutions. By aligning national strategies with the principles of open-source development, governments can create a more vibrant and innovative technological ecosystem. Hugging Face’s appeal to the US government reflects an understanding of these benefits and the need for supportive policies to harness the full potential of open-source AI.
